随着软件版本不断更新,jenkin对基础环境也有相应的变化。例如对java版本。安装前先看一看 当前Jenkins版本安装所需的基础环境要求
Installing Jenkins
yum install fontconfig java-11-openjdk
2.安装mavenwget https://dlcdn.apache.org/maven/maven-3/3.8.6/binaries/apache-maven-3.8.6-bin.tar.gz
tar -zxf apache-maven-3.8.6-bin.tar.gz
mv apache-maven-3.8.6 /usr/local/
ln -s /usr/local/apache-maven-3.8.6 /usr/local/maven
[root@ap-jenkins01 ~]# whereis java
java: /usr/bin/java /usr/lib/java /etc/java /usr/share/java /usr/lib/jvm/java-11-openjdk-11.0.16.0.8-1.el7_9.x86_64/bin/java /usr/share/man/man1/java.1.gz
[root@ap-jenkins01 ~]# whereis maven
maven: /etc/maven /usr/local/maven
vim /etc/porfile
3.3 maven配置国内连接仓库
vim /usr/local/apache-maven-3.8.3/conf/settings.xml
二、Jenkins安装 1.jenkins 仓库下载alimaven aliyun maven http://maven.aliyun.com/nexus/content/groups/public/ central
2.jenkins安装-yumwget -O /etc/yum.repos.d/jenkins.repo https://pkg.jenkins.io/redhat-stable/jenkins.repo
sudo rpm --import https://pkg.jenkins.io/redhat-stable/jenkins.io.key
3.jenkins插件安装yum install jenkins -y
systemctl daemon-reload
systemctl enable jenkins && systemctl start jenkins && systemctl status jenkins
安装kubernetes插件
Kubernetes Cli Plugin:该插件可直接在Jenkins中使用kubernetes命令行进行操作。
Kubernetes plugin:使用kubernetes则需要安装该插件
Kubernetes Continuous Deploy Plugin:kubernetes部署插件,可根据需要使用
还有更多的插件可供选择,可点击 系统管理->管理插件进行管理和添加,
安装相应的Docker插件、SSH插件、Maven插件。其他的插件可以根据需要进行安装。
安装git插件
GitLab
Gitlab Api
Gitlab Hook
Gitlab Authentication
GitLab Logo
安装maven
maven
ssh
SSH
Publish Over SSH
.git/svn客户端,因一般代码是放在git/svn服务器上的,我们需要拉取代码。
yum -y install git #安装git 客户端,该命令能拉取代码
后端jenkins主配置文件 /etc/sysconfig/jenkins